Optional equipment were 3.55 gears and radar detector. Sent to Ciener Woods Ford.

One of 5 Twilight Blue 1991 Saleen Mustangs.

Of these five:

1 - 2-door coupe
1 - Convertible
3 - 3-door hatchbacks

Of the three hatchbacks, two were standard models (non SC).

You probably have the final Twilight Blue paint 1991 Saleen Mustang produced.

The standard color cloth FloFit seats in 1990 and 1991 are grey. These grey seats do not match the titanium Ford interior plastics.

Whether you purchased a titanium interior or black interior Ford Mustang for Saleen conversion, both received the same grey cloth FloFits.

The standard color for the optional leather Saleen FloFits were tu-tone dark gray and titanium. Same applies, these seats were installed in both the titanium and the black interior cars.

There are exceptions. Some of the SC cars have tu-tone cloth seats that match the Ford interior, some people ordered solid color leather FloFits, etc.


Yes, the silver side stripes are charcoal.
